Performance:
- Continued improvement in processor technology: Expect more powerful and energy-efficient CPUs, possibly utilizing smaller process nodes.
- Enhanced graphics capabilities: Integrated and dedicated GPUs may see advancements, providing better performance for gaming and graphics-intensive tasks.
Design and Form Factor:
- Thinner and lighter laptops: Manufacturers will likely continue to focus on creating sleek and portable designs.
- Innovative form factors: Foldable or dual-screen laptops may become more prevalent, offering new ways to interact with devices.
Display Technology:
- Higher refresh rates: Expect more laptops with displays featuring higher refresh rates, especially for gaming laptops.
- Improved color accuracy: Displays may continue to improve in terms of color reproduction, benefiting content creators and professionals.
Connectivity:
- Increased adoption of USB4/Thunderbolt 4: Faster data transfer speeds and improved connectivity options.
- Wi-Fi 6/6E: Laptops may come equipped with the latest Wi-Fi standards for faster and more reliable wireless connections.
Battery Life:
- Improved energy efficiency: Advances in battery technology may lead to longer battery life for laptops.
- More focus on sustainable materials: Manufacturers may prioritize e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ient components.
Security Features:
- Enhanced biometric authentication: More laptops may include advanced fingerprint scanners or facial recognition for secure logins.
- Improved privacy features: Built-in webcam shutters and microphone mute buttons to address privacy concerns.
AI Integration:
- AI-powered features: Integration of artificial intelligence for improved performance, efficiency, and user experience.
Storage:
- Increased use of SSDs: Expect SSDs to become more standard, with larger capacities and faster read/write speeds.
- Potential for new storage technologies: Emerging storage solutions may find their way into laptops, offering faster and more reliable data storage.
Software and Operating Systems:
- Continued adoption of Windows 11, macOS, and Linux: Operating systems may evolve to better support new hardware features and user experiences.
- Enhanced software optimization: Applications may be optimized to take advantage of the latest hardware capabilities.
